Why AI Validator

A different approach to inspection.

Traditional AI inspection demands huge labeled datasets and long setup. AI Validator learns from images of good product and catches defects it has never seen before.

Current AI solutions
AI Validator
1000s of labeled defect images required
30 to 60 good images + a few defects
Rigid, detects only trained defects
Adaptive, detects unknown defects
Coding / data prep required
No coding, GUI based
Setup time: months
Setup time: hours
Deployment

Deploy on the edge, in your private network, or in your private cloud.

AI Validator adapts to your security and infrastructure requirements. We understand you want your data private, so we designed AI Validator to be deployed on the edge, or in private networks, while also giving you the option to deploy it in your private cloud.

Edge

Run inference directly on the edge, using fixed cameras connected to station compute HW, for automated inspection in real-time on the line. Your data never has to leave the floor.

Private network & on-prem

Deploy inside your own secure network on physical or virtual machines, keeping data and access under your control and accessible from multiple inspection stations.

Private cloud

Deploy AI Validator in your own private cloud so it scales with your workloads while staying inside your infrastructure and security perimeter.
